AEGN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review
158 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aegion Corp (AEGN)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$552M — down 10% from $615M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new AEGN posit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 63 added to existing stakes and 48 trimmed.
The largest buyer was AllianceBernstein, adding an estimated $9.3M. The largest seller was Guggenheim Capital, cutting an estimated $6.01M.
